Abstract:

We have revised our assessment of equity content in DONG Energy A/S' €700 million hybrid securities, due 3010, to minimal from high, after reviewing the instrument under our updated criteria published in April. DONG Energy has announced an exchange offer, which combined with the issue of new hybrid securities, is intended to replace the €700 million hybrid instrument. We are affirming our 'BBB+/A-2' ratings on DONG Energy. The negative outlook reflects our view that DONG Energy could find it difficult to improve its financial risk profile to a level commensurate with the current rating over the next 12-18 months.
